Configuración de la pasarela de servlet para un servidor de aplicaciones

Si despliega IBM® Cognos en un servidor de aplicaciones distinto de Tomcat, puede utilizar la pasarela de servlet para dar servicio a las páginas del portal en lugar de utilizar un servidor web.

Antes de empezar

Asegúrese de que se han efectuado las tareas siguientes:

  • El servidor de aplicaciones está instalado y se ejecuta en todos los sistemas en los que va a instalarse la pasarela del servlet.
  • Los componentes de pasarela de IBM Cognos se instalan en el mismo sistema que el servidor de aplicaciones.
  • Los componentes de nivel de aplicación de IBM Cognos BI y Content Manager se instalan y ejecutan en el entorno.
  • La cuenta de usuario del servidor de aplicaciones tiene permiso de acceso completo para la instalación de IBM Cognos.

Acerca de esta tarea

En lugar de direccionar las solicitudes directamente al asignador, puede desplegar la pasarela de servlet en una instancia de JVM distinta de las instancias de JVM que ejecutan los servlets de componentes de nivel de aplicación de IBM Cognos BI y de Content Manager. Con este tipo de despliegue se separa la carga para servir contenido estático de las aplicaciones principales.

Procedimiento

  1. Cree una instancia JVM independiente, si es necesario.

    Si tiene previsto ejecutar IBM Cognos BI y la pasarela del servlet de IBM Cognos en el mismo servidor de aplicaciones, la pasarela del servlet debe desplegarse en una instancia JVM independiente.

  2. Compruebe que los componentes de IBM Cognos están configurados correctamente.
  3. Configure las variables de entorno.
  4. Configure la pasarela de servlet de IBM Cognos para que se ejecute en el servidor de aplicaciones.
  5. Modifique el script de inicio del servidor de aplicaciones, si es necesario.
  6. Configure las propiedades del servidor de aplicaciones y despliegue la pasarela de servlet de IBM Cognos.
  7. Habilite SSL, si es necesario.

Resultados

Ahora puede acceder a los componentes de IBM Cognos utilizando la pasarela de servlet mediante la especificación del URI de pasarela. Por ejemplo, http[s]:nombre_host:puerto/ServletGateway.

El URI de pasarela del servlet de IBM Cognos distingue entre mayúsculas y minúsculas.